>From what I heard this evening, it is clearly a hotel.  There is still quite a bit of
activity at the old DC General, I think that the Correctional Treatment Facility is
there, plus a residential detox center, and possibly EPRD (Emergency Psych Response
Division?).  The place is far from closed.

Tonight on 464.4250 I heard someone calling "engineering" because the guest in room
XXX was hot even though the thermostat was set all the way cold, and the guest in
room XXX couldn't find his Ethernet cable.  Security was asked to report to
(somewhere near) the mail room.  I'm pretty sure it is a hotel, but I can't tell
which one.  Definitely better service than DCGH, St. E's, or even a college dorm
would give.
